If the boy is still a child, pre-adolescent, he can be described as being beautiful.
He's a beautiful baby/child/boy
sounds perfectly acceptable to my ears. The boy himself might object to being called beautiful once he turns into a teenager, as it is usually considered an effeminate term.
For teenagers and adults, the genderless adjectives good-looking, and attractive are the safest and best-known options. They can be used for young and “mature” people, both men and women.
Good-looking as defined by Oxford Dictionaries (Chiefly of a person) attractive.
